Caddy is a web server like Apache, nginx, or lighttpd, but with different goals, features, and advantages.

Comments and Reviews
It is perfect if you need a lightweight and easy-to-use reverse proxy and/or web server for a small project, but if you need max performance with lowest possible latency you should replace Caddy with Nginx
Caddy is ready to serve your site in 1 second, it has flexible configuration options, HTTPS, hot reload and lots of plugins to extend server configuration. Why should you look for something else?
